In 1994, only Steve Trachsel of the Chicago Cubs had both as many assists (33) and as few double plays (0).

closest were Jose Rijo of the Cincinnati Reds (27, 0), Randy Johnson of the Seattle Mariners (27, 0), Steve Avery of the Atlanta Braves (26, 0), and Jack McDowell of the Chicago White Sox (23, 0), ending with Butch Henry of the Montreal Expos (13, 3).

Steve Trachsel of the 1994 Chicago Cubs threw right-handed, played on a losing team, attended California State University, Long Beach, played in Wrigley Field, and was born in California.
